Functions

func DefaultCtxOptions

func DefaultCtxOptions() []string

DefaultCtxOptions used for enableAnnotations where it sets the source and destination labels so users will not have to manually define.

func DefaultMetrics

func DefaultMetrics() []string

DefaultMetrics used for enableAnnotations where it sets enabled advanced metrics so users will not have to manually define. For any new advanced metrics we want to have enabled by default for annotation based solution, add it here.
